Output ebcbfb649bdc0264e594d30ec2e4e1510b5c75916e7f0802ea0a9cce4d5eb000:1

value
586184
script pubkey
OP_0 OP_PUSHBYTES_20 8be4f1e0340632ef2cad6493d2b134e8351f36a5
address
bc1q30j0rcp5qcew7t9dvjfa9vf5aq637d499xls9p
transaction
ebcbfb649bdc0264e594d30ec2e4e1510b5c75916e7f0802ea0a9cce4d5eb000
confirmations
167751
spent
true